What Are the Causes of Bow Legs?

The causes of bowed legs can vary widely, depending on the particular person and their circumstances. For example, people whose bowed legs are caused by a birth defect such as clubfoot may have several corrective surgeries over the course of their childhood.

Others may develop bowed legs as they grow older, due to osteoarthritis or other conditions that can cause joint tenderness and pain. Some people may have a barely noticeable curve in their knees, while others may have a very pronounced curve that causes a significant limp.
